Transaction 1226effe7e853fa6504aedd9286523a63f592fc194e31ce994d02b1f0557b8dd
1 Input
1 Output
-
1226effe7e853fa6504aedd9286523a63f592fc194e31ce994d02b1f0557b8dd:0
- value
- 5097971
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877d0fa5bf0bcbc3605483544162231f05dc391b OP_EQUAL
- address
- 3E3Qxqg3ok55QPMUvoowijJSy1iD7Aqj8T